当a=1,b=2,c=3时,执行if(a

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/04 12:31:03
当a=1,b=2,c=3时,执行if(a

当a=1,b=2,c=3时,执行if(a
当a=1,b=2,c=3时,执行if(a

当a=1,b=2,c=3时,执行if(a
if语句不加花括号只会执行到它后面的第一个分号为止,即b=a;后就会跳出if语句,所以最好这样:
if(a

IF是如果的意思,a于是下面那三个等号式子的意思是把等号后面的数值给前面的数值。即把A给B,就是把1给B,就是a=1b=1以此类推。第二个就是把C给A,就是C=3给了A,就是c=3.a=3.,第三个就是B给C,这里要注意的是,这里的b不是题目里的B了,而是第一个式子赋值了的新的B 值。于是第三个式子里面b=1,c=1
最终答案:a=3 b=1 c=1...

全部展开

IF是如果的意思,a于是下面那三个等号式子的意思是把等号后面的数值给前面的数值。即把A给B,就是把1给B,就是a=1b=1以此类推。第二个就是把C给A,就是C=3给了A,就是c=3.a=3.,第三个就是B给C,这里要注意的是,这里的b不是题目里的B了,而是第一个式子赋值了的新的B 值。于是第三个式子里面b=1,c=1
最终答案:a=3 b=1 c=1

收起

当a=1,b=2,c=3时,执行if(a C语言IF的问题当a=1,b=2,c=3时,以下if语句执行后,a,b,c中的值分别是多少if (a>c)b=a;a=c;c=b; 当a=1,b=2,c=3时,以下if语句执行后,a、b、c中的值分别是求大神帮助当a=1,b=2,c=3时,以下if语句执行后,a、b、c中的值分别是 if(a>c) b=a;a=c;c=b; 当a=1 b=2 c=3,执行以下程序b=?if(a>c)b=a;a=c;c=b; | 当a=3,b=2,c=1;时,执行以下程序段后 c=_____.if(a>b) a=b; if(b>c) b=c; else c=b; c=a;当a=3,b=2,c=1;时,执行以下程序段后 c=_____.if(a>b) a=b; if(b>c) b=c; else c=b;c=a; 当a=1,b=2,c=3时,以下if语句执行后,a,b,c中的值分别为多少? if(a>c) b=a当a=1,b=2,c=3时,以下if语句执行后,a,b,c中的值分别为多少?if(a>c)b=a,a=c,c=b;求详细解释 当a=3,b=2,c=1时,执行以下if语句后a=?b=?c=?if(a>b) a=b;if(b>c) b=c;else c=b; c=a; C语言中的if语句当a=1,b=2,c=3时,以下if语句执行后,a、b、c中的值分别为()、()、().if(a>c)b=a;a=c;c=b; .当a=1,b=3,c=5,d=4时,执行完下面一段程序后x的值是if (a 当a=1,b=2,c=3时,以下if语句执行后,a 、b、 c 中的值分别为()()()if(a>c)b=a;a=c;c=b;答案是3、2、2, 当a=2,b=3,c=4,d=5时,执行下面一段程序后x的值为if(a>b)  if(c 当a=1,b=3,c=5,d=4 ,执行完下面一段程序后x 的值是 ( ) if(a C语言小练习,在线等5、C语言中一条语句以____ __结束. 6、当a=1,b=2,c=3时,以下语句执行后,a 、b 、c 中的值分别为__ _、 _ __、 __ _. if(a>c) b=a; a=c; c=b; 设有定义:int a=1,b=2,c=3;,以下语句中执行效果与其它三个不同的是?A.if(a>b) c=a,a=b,b=c; B.if(a>b){ c=a,a=b,b=c;}C.if(a>b) c=a;a=b;b=c;D.if(a>b){ c=a;a=b;b=c;} 当a=2,b=3,c=1时,执行以下程序段后,输出结果是if(a>b)if(a>c)printf( %d ,a);elseprintf( %d ,b);printf( end );我觉得应该是:3 end可是答案只是end,请问应该是什么?因为计算机里没有编译软件,所以不好 当x=1,y=2,z=3时,以下语句执行后,a,b,c中的值分别为________ if(x>y) y=x;x=z;z=x; 6.while循环终 已知int a=1,b=2,c=3;以下语句执行后a,b,c的值是.if(a〉b)c=a;a=b;b=c; a=1, b=2,c=3; if(a>c) b=a;a=c;c=b; a>c表达式为假,为啥还要执行后面的